Telesales pay is a lower base with real upside through commission, rewarding volume and consistency. If you're hiring or benchmarking, the figures below give a realistic picture of what a Telesales Executive costs in the current market.

⚡ In short

A Telesales Executive in the UK typically earns a base salary of £22k to £32k, with a median of around £26k, plus commission.

Pay rises with experience, sits higher in London and high-growth sectors, and the total package can be well above base once incentives are included.

£26k

Median base salary

£22k-£32k

Typical range

+5-15%

London premium

£32k-£40k OTE

On-target earnings

Telesales Executive salary by experience

Experience Level
Typical Salary
Entry-level / Newly Appointed
£22k-£25k
Experienced
£25k-£29k
Senior / Lead
£29k-£34k

How to benchmark and set the salary

1. Start with the market range
For a Telesales Executive, that's roughly £22k to £32k base. Pitch too low and you won't get replies; too high and you overpay.

2. Adjust for experience
Use the bands in the table above - entry, experienced and senior - rather than a single figure, and match the level you actually need.

3. Factor in location
London and the South East add 5-15%. A remote or regional role can be pitched a little lower for the same calibre.

4. Add the incentive
Commission is central to telesales, often taking OTE 30-60% above base for strong performers. Candidates compare total earnings, so lead with the package, not just the base.

5. Move at the right speed
Strong sales people have options. A competitive offer made quickly beats a slightly higher one that drags.

Frequently asked questions

How much does a Telesales Executive earn in the UK?

A Telesales Executive typically earns a base salary of £22k to £32k, with a median around £26k.

Plus commission, so total earnings are usually higher than base alone.

What's the starting salary for a Telesales Executive?

Entry-level or newly appointed Telesales Executives usually start around £22k-£25k.

The figure rises with proven results, sector experience and location, so a strong track record commands more from day one.

Do Telesales Executives earn more in London?

Yes. London and the South East typically add +5-15% to base for a Telesales Executive, reflecting higher living costs and competition for talent.

Remote and regional roles can be pitched a little lower for the same calibre of candidate.

What affects a Telesales Executive's salary?

The main drivers are experience, sector, location and company size, plus the structure of any bonus or commission.

For a Telesales Executive specifically, commission plan tends to move the numbers most, so weigh that when you benchmark.

What bonus or commission does a Telesales Executive get?

Commission is central to telesales, often taking OTE 30-60% above base for strong performers.

Always compare total on-target earnings rather than base alone, since the incentive can be a large share of the package.
